A Northern Ireland mother successfully sued her employer for sex discrimination after they refused her a promotion because of her role as a primary carer for her children. The tribunal awarded her a significant payout, exposing how family duties still hinder women's career advancement. It underscores persistent inequalities in employment despite legal protections.
